On 05/06/2014 02:28 PM, Simon Glass wrote:
...
> The GPIO uclass does sequentially number GPIOs, but be aware that on
> platforms with multiple GPIO controllers (e.g. an I2C GPIO extender) you
> might hit a problem where the tegra GPIOs are not first, so might start
> at 8 or 16, for example. However I think that probably can be resolved
> when we come to it.

That fact shouldn't be exposed to the user. If all the GPIO IDs are
relative to a specific named GPIO device, then the user will never see
the internal offset. Indeed, the GPIO driver for a particular GPIO HW
module/chip wouldn't ever see the offset either. In fact, we shouldn't
have/introduce a flat/global GPIO numbering space at all. The Linux
community has learned that doesn't work very well, and is moving away
from it in the more recent "gpiod" API for example. Everything should be
identified as a tuple (GPIO controller handle, GPIO ID within that GPIO
controller).
